Celebs Lend Their Voices For #BlackOutTuesday
The world is currently up in arms over the disregard for black lives in the US and other country that has been marred with racism including SA.

Some celebs in Mzansi are lending their voice for the movement which also saw the death of 40-year-old Collins Khosa, who was killed after an alleged altercation with the SANDF and metro officers in his home in Johannesburg.

Showing unity, ZAlebs have protested online to show their support for the cause by blacking out their Instagram accounts which symbolizes a moment of silence for victims.

Tuesday has been said to be the day in which people can support the movement by making their social media profiles blank or post blank pictures.

Racism and police brutality gave birth to the Black Lives Matter movement which has now gained so many people.
